1998 DX, 119k miles, 5 speed. Seller was selling it cheap because it was "lurching" in first/second gears and popping out of 5th. Good condition overall aside from the lurching.
Hooked up my trusty laptop, scanned for codes. A few popped up, cleared them, the CEL came back on...fuel trim. Hmmm. Major vacuum leak?
Look under the hood. See a big slit in the air hose. roll my eyes, offer the guy $400. He was selling it because his "mechanic" said the transmission was shot. Put two and two together and deduct that the engine movement is causing the tube to open up causing the engine to momentarily die as too much air gets in that isn't metered...as th engine moves back into place the hole closes and the engine can breathe again....seriously we're talking fuel trims around +20 on my software.
Go to Lowe's, get some duct tape. Pay the guy, get the title, drive down the street. Park it, tape up the hole, reset the ECU.
Drives like a dream now. No more codes, exhaust is clean smelling, fuel trims are normal (same as my 97 Pro) and the O2 sensors are reading normal again. Still pops out of 5th but I'm hoping that's due to some obviously broken engine mounts.
